Polyalthia evecta

Polyalthia evecta, commonly known as the Evecta or Evergreen Polyalthia, is a versatile medicinal shrub celebrated in traditional herbalism. Renowned for its bioactive properties, this plant offers significant therapeutic potential. It is frequently utilized to support digestive health, reduce inflammation, and provide antioxidant benefits within various holistic healing practices.

  • Scientific name: Polyalthia evecta
  • Family: Annonaceae
  • Native range: Asia-Tropical

Distribution

This plant is primarily distributed throughout the Indo-China region. Within this expansive area, it can be found growing in the tropical landscapes of Cambodia. Its natural habitat also extends into the diverse ecosystems of Laos. Furthermore, the species is widely documented across various parts of Thailand. Finally, the geographical range of this medicinal plant includes the forested terrains of Vietnam.

Chemicals

Polyalthia evecta has 3 reported phytochemicals identified across 3 scientific publications and several other databases. The most consistently reported chemicals include 1-(2-furyl)pentacosa-7,9-diyne, 19-(2-furyl)nonadeca-5,7-diynoic acid, 19-(2-furyl)nonadeca-5-ynoic acid.
